First, think beyond a simple internet search. Our tight-knit community is your greatest resource. Start by asking for recommendations at Wall Drug, your local vet's office, or even the Wall Post Office. Word-of-mouth referrals from fellow pet owners carry immense weight and often lead to the most reliable, experienced sitters who understand the needs of dogs in our area, from high-energy herding breeds to seasoned senior pups.
When you meet a potential sitter, go beyond the basics. A great local sitter will ask questions that show genuine care: "Does your dog do well with the sounds of summer thunder rolling across the plains?" or "Should we avoid the prairie dog towns on our walk?" They should be eager to know your dog's routine, favorite walking routes (maybe around the school park or a quiet neighborhood loop), and any specific anxieties. Be sure to provide clear instructions on diet, medication, and emergency contacts, including your vet and a backup.
For a trial run, consider a shorter engagement first. Hire the sitter for a couple of hours while you enjoy a leisurely lunch in town. This allows your dog to get comfortable in their care without the stress of a full-day absence. Observe how they interact; a good sitter will be confident yet calm, respecting your dog's space while offering gentle engagement.
Finally, ensure they are prepared for our specific environment. A responsible dog babysitter in Wall should be aware of seasonal hazards like summer heat on exposed sidewalks, winter's bitter chill, and local wildlife. They should always use a leash (our open spaces are tempting but not always safe) and have a plan for sudden weather changes. Providing them with a spare key to your home and a neighbor's contact info adds an extra layer of security.
